The video tutorial by Renette focuses on teaching senior high school students how to formulate claims and counterclaims. It begins with a recap of previous lessons on assertions and moves on to explain the concepts of claims and counterclaims, their elements, and how they are used in arguments. The tutorial provides real-world examples and guides students on writing argumentative essays. It concludes with a discussion on the application of these concepts in academic writing.
